    Learning outcomes of the course
    Purpose:
    Materials management can have a significant impact on a company's profit, logistics efficiency and customer service. In global supply chains and e-commerce, the importance of material management components, such as demand forecasting, inventory level management, selecting production strategy and planning capacity, is becoming increasingly important. In this course you will learn how to plan and manage material flows. After completing this course, you will understand the basic principles, key concepts and theories of material management and their implications for business.

    Learning outcomes:
    - You will understand the importance of demand forecasting in business and the most common methods of forecasting.
    - You will understand the basics and importance of product data management and bill of materials in business point of view.
    - You will understand how material flows and inventory levels can be managed and controlled. You understand how to minimize costs of material flow and inventory can be minimize.
    - You will understand the basic principles of production control management as well as the different production strategies and their importance for business.
    - You will understand how machine, space and personnel capacity is can be determined and understand the basic principles of capacity management.
    Course contents
    - Demand forecasting
    - Inventory management and material requirements planning
    - Product data management
    - Production control management
    - Capacity management
